  • Binondo: Directly adjacent to Chinatown, Binondo is the oldest Chinatown in the world and a fascinating neighbourhood steeped in history. Known for its rich culinary scene, it is a haven for food lovers eager to sample authentic Chinese cuisine. The area attracts visitors throughout the year, with peak periods in January to February and July. Binondo is home to bustling markets and numerous places of worship, including beautiful churches and historic buildings. Its vibrant atmosphere and cultural diversity make it an ideal spot for families and those seeking a unique city experience.

  • Rizal Park: A sprawling urban oasis, Rizal Park offers a blend of outdoor relaxation and family-friendly activities. With its lush gardens, historical monuments, and vibrant atmosphere, it's an ideal spot to unwind and soak in the city vibes just 1.6km from Chinatown.
  • Manila Cathedral: Located 1.1km away from Chinatown, the Manila Cathedral is a stunning example of neo-Romanesque architecture. Its intricate designs and rich history provide a cultural experience, making it a must-visit for those interested in heritage and spirituality.
  • Quiapo Church: Situated 966m from Chinatown, Quiapo Church is a cultural landmark known for its vibrant atmosphere and deep-rooted traditions. Visitors can immerse themselves in the local faith and experience the lively street scene surrounding this iconic church.

Best time to go to Chinatown

The best time to visit Chinatown is dependent on what kind of holiday you are seeking. May is its hottest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ly sunny with light rain. January is its coolest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are slightly high and weather is mostly sunny with no rain.

The nearest major airports for your trip to Chinatown

To reach Chinatown in Manila, the primary airport is Ninoy Aquino International Airport (MNL), situated 11.3km away. Notable hotels nearby include the 5-star Conrad Manila, located 3.2km from the airport, and the 5-star Dusit Thani Manila, which is 4.8km away. Both hotels offer convenient access to the airport. Another option is the City Garden GRAND Hotel, positioned 6.4km from MNL. Alternatively, Angeles City’s Clark International Airport (CRK) is 78.9km distant, with excellent accommodations such as the Clark Marriott Hotel and Swissotel Clark Philippines, both just 3.2km away. Olongapo's Subic Bay International Airport (SFS) is also 78.9km from Chinatown, with several hotels nearby.

What are the top things to see and do in Chinatown?
If you're looking forward to a day of shopping in Chinatown, consider Lucky Chinatown Mall or 168 Mall, and pick out the perfect souvenir. As you're discovering the neighborhood, Pasig River and Plaza San Lorenzo Ruiz are some other places worth a visit. A few places to visit in the area around Chinatown include Divisoria Market, Plaza Lacson, and Old Congress Building. While you're out sightseeing, Central Post Office and Almacenes Curtain Wall are a couple of additional sights to visit in Manila.
